Steps to Turn Off Sound Guide on Samsung TV
Now that we understand the why, let’s jump into the how. There are several methods you can use to disable the Sound Guide depending on your specific model and settings.
Using the Remote Control
The most straightforward method is to use your Samsung TV remote. Here’s how you can do that:
Step 1: Locate the Menu Button
Find the Menu button or Home button on your Samsung remote to access the smart hub. This button usually has an icon that looks like a house or a grid of squares.
Step 2: Navigate to Settings
Using the arrow keys on your remote, scroll to the Settings option, which might be indicated by a gear icon.
Step 3: Select Accessibility
Within the Settings menu, scroll down until you find Accessibility settings. This might vary slightly depending on the model, but it is typically located near the bottom of the menu.
Step 4: Turn Off Sound Guide
In the Accessibility settings, look for the Sound Guide option. Press enter or select the option, and you will see an option to turn it off. Toggle it to disable the Sound Guide.
Step 5: Confirm Changes
Once you’ve turned it off, ensure the change has been made by navigating back and checking if the Sound Guide is now inactive.

Using the Quick Settings Menu
Some Samsung TV models also allow you to remove the Sound Guide through the Quick Settings menu.
Step 1: Access Quick Settings
Press the Home button on your remote, followed by the up arrow to access the Quick Settings.
Step 2: Find the Sound Guide Option
Scroll through the options presented. You should see the Sound options that include Sound Guide.
Step 3: Toggle Sound Guide Off
Select the Sound Guide option, and you should be able to toggle it off swiftly through this menu.

Is there a way to turn off Sound Guide without using the remote?
Yes, you can turn off the Sound Guide on your Samsung TV without using the remote by utilizing the buttons on the TV itself. Most Samsung TVs have a panel located on the side or back. Locate the volume or menu button on the panel to bring up the on-screen menu.
Once the menu is displayed, navigate to the “Settings” section, and look for the “Accessibility” or “Voice Guide” options. Once you find the Voice Guide setting, you can disable it using the buttons on the TV. This allows you to manage settings even if the remote control is misplaced or malfunctioning.

What if I still hear audio descriptions after turning off Sound Guide?
If you continue to hear audio descriptions even after disabling the Sound Guide, there may be another setting related to audio descriptions enabled in your TV. Some content providers or streaming apps have their own audio description settings that can override the general TV settings. Make sure to check within the specific app’s settings or audio options to see if audio description is turned on.
Additionally, it may be beneficial to perform a quick restart of your TV to ensure that all settings updates are applied correctly. If issues persist, reviewing the user manual or Samsung’s support website may provide insights into addressing this issue further, ensuring a seamless viewing experience without unwanted audio descriptions.
